Humboldt is world famous for it's underground marijuana cultivation culture. People flock to that region EVERY FALL for trimming season it's ridiculous. I saw people on the side of the 101 with signs or giant trimming scissors saying "Looking for trim work" and that's literally how people get their trim jobs. Growers used to meet up at a bar in Arcata, CA to find most of their trimmers and make deal arrangements, until last year when they shut it down.
